The people’s main event at UFC 281 was delivered as promised. Lightweight fighters Michael Chandler and Dustin Poirier left it all inside the Octagon at the Madison Square Garden with an all-time classic contest.

Official Decision: Dustin Poirier wins via submission (Round 3 RNC).

At the mecca of fighting, ‘The Diamond’ and ‘Iron’, two of the absolute bests in UFC’s toughest division, showcased their undeniable heart.

ADVERTISEMENT

The first round was two nothing short of two trucks colliding with each other. A collision that gave the fans the moment they will remember forever; A new contender for the round of the year. While Michael Chandler found early success, Dustin Poirier survived and paid the former Bellator fighter for not finishing him.

Chandler turned the tables in the second round. The credential wrestler took the fight to the mat and dominated on the ground. However, Poirier survived and came back strong in the third round. Another botched takedown from ‘Iron’ provided the former UFC interim lightweight champion the opportunity to take the back and secure the submission.

“Of course,” Poirier said when Joe Rogan asked if he was in trouble.

“Who ain’t got jiujitsu,” ‘The Diamond’ took a dig at the current UFC lightweight champion Islam Makhachev after the RNC finish of the top lightweight contender.

The bout between Alexander Volkanovski and Islam Makhachev is already scheduled for UFC Australia PPV. Hence, Dustin Poirier will need to wait for his opportunity at the lightweight title.
